Output 5268979fef882bf6a35d81c4e663b27d42e0e988a9d8fbecd27cb50b7529787e:2

value
502992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e67b4d078d72a2c0654d7c56a81d37a9549fb9 OP_EQUAL
address
3KBh6L29hU9aBkv6gmZSUAsKGfniWpGY5i
transaction
5268979fef882bf6a35d81c4e663b27d42e0e988a9d8fbecd27cb50b7529787e
spent
true